Cyclohexanecarboxylic acid Uses

 Hexahydrobenzoic acid (CAS NO.98-89-5) is a raw material for synthesis of Clofentezine.
 Hexahydrobenzoic acid (CAS NO.98-89-5) can also be used for synthesis of new varieties of other acaricides Flufenzine (flutenzine)
 Hexahydrobenzoic acid (CAS NO.98-89-5) can also be used as pharmaceuticals, dyes intermediates.

Cyclohexanecarboxylic acid Safety Profile

Safety Information  Hexahydrobenzoic acid (CAS NO.98-89-5):
Hazard Codes:Xi
Risk Statements:37/38-41-36/37/38
37/38:Irritating to respiratory system and skin 
41:Risk of serious damage to eyes
36/37/38:Irritating to eyes, respiratory system and skin    
Safety Statements:26-36-37/39
26:In case of contact with eyes, rinse immediately with plenty of water and seek medical advice 
36:Wear suitable protective clothing 
37/39:Wear suitable gloves and eye/face protection  
WGK Germany:2
RTECS:GU8370000
Moderately toxic by ingestion. When heated to decomposition it emits acrid smoke and irritating vapors.

Cyclohexanecarboxylic acid Specification

First Aid Measures of Hexahydrobenzoic acid (CAS NO.98-89-5):
Eyes: Flush eyes with plenty of water for at least 15 minutes, occasionally lifting the upper and lower eyelids. Get medical aid. 
Skin: Get medical aid. Flush skin with plenty of water for at least 15 minutes while removing contaminated clothing and shoes.  Ingestion: Get medical aid. Wash mouth out with water. 
Inhalation: Remove from exposure and move to fresh air immediately. If not breathing, give artificial respiration. If breathing is difficult, give oxygen. Get medical aid. 
Storage of Hexahydrobenzoic acid (CAS NO.98-89-5):
Store in a cool, dry place. Store in a tightly closed container.
